Traditional: white dove, peace/love, symbol of the spirit. Literary elements that recur in the literature of multiple cultures. Allegory: story seems to be about something but it is about something else example the bible. Metonymy: use of one thing to refer to another thing (208) Synecdoche: part represents the whole, a sail refers to a ship. Haitian descent, the first caribbean island to become independent.
